Montclair Art Museum launches MAM Conversations Series

MONTCLAIR, NJ — Montclair Art Museum is transforming the annual Julia Norton Babson Memorial Lecture into the MAM Conversations presented by the Babson Lecture Series, funded, in part, by a perpetual gift from the Julia Norton Babson Memorial Fund.

MAM Conversations will give community members the unique opportunity to engage virtually with contemporary artists, see their studio spaces, and learn more about their work through question-and-answer sessions — all without leaving the house. 

“I’m always excited when I get the chance to visit an artist in their own space,” assistant curator Alison Van Denend said. “An artist’s studio can provide unique insight into their personality, process and what inspires them. We’re thrilled to be able to share these glimpses inside the artist’s studio with the members and friends of MAM.”

“The MAM Conversations series offers our members and friends around the world the opportunity to engage live with contemporary artists across a range of backgrounds and media,” MAM interim Director Ira Wagner said. “We are grateful to the Julia Norton Babson Memorial Fund for the support to make this happen.”

MAM Conversations will take place on Thursdays from June 11 through Aug. 28 at 6 p.m. via Zoom webinars. The fee to attend is free for members and charged for non-members. The remaining schedule is as follows: June 18, Philemona Williamson; June 25, Tom Nussbaum; July 2, Virgil Ortiz and Tish Agoyo; and July 9, Willie Cole. Additional artists for July 16 through Aug. 28 will be announced.
